git - vyšší dívčí
Tom Meinlschmidt
hw na meinlschmidt.org
Pátek Listopad 25 09:56:22 CET 2016
zdravim,
otazky uz byly zodpovezeny, ja jen doporucim
https://knihy.nic.cz/files/nic/edice/scott_chacon_pro_git.pdf
tm
ps: stoji za to kouknout na rebase vs merge
On 2016-11-25 07:43, Pavel Troller wrote:
> Zdravím,
> díky rychlokursu od členů této konference jsem se naučil relativně
> běžnou
> práci s gitem. Pracuji si na svém repository, občas udělám pull z
> hlavní
> repository, vyřeším kolize, které někdy vzniknou, addnu, commitnu, píšu
> vlastní
> patche, ty taky commitnu atd.
> Nyní ale potřebuji dostat se dále a tam zatím nic neumím :-).
> Vezměme to prakticky. Mám privátní repository Asterisku a zatím
> všechny
> mé úpravy byly ve větvi Asterisk 11.
> Nyní bych potřeboval následující:
> 1) Získat diff oproti "master" gitu - tedy vše, co jsem tam upravil.
> Něco
> jako svn diff, tam je to běžné. Ale git diff mi nevypíše nic, protože
> všechny
> své změny commituji a pokud jsem to správně pochopil, git diff vypisuje
> změny proti "lokálnímu" repository a tam tedy po commitu žádné běžně
> nejsou.
> 2) Přejít s vývojem na jiný branch - např. Asterisk 15 nebo možná i
> HEAD.
> To s sebou nese následující úlohy:
> 1) Vytvořit viditelnou lokální repository tohoto (ale chci, aby ta s
> větví
> Asterisk 11 zůstala nadále viditelná a beze změn)
> 2) Pokus o přeportování mých úprav z větve 11 do této. Teoreticky
> pokud budu
> mít ten diff, tak to řeší obyčejný příkaz patch v té nové repository,
> ale
> zajímá mne, zda to umí git tak nějak přirozeně. Samozřejmě tam bude
> spousta
> chyb, které budu muset řešit ručně, ale na to jsem připraven.
> Děkuji předem za další lekci :-).
> Zdraví Pavel
> _______________________________________________
> HW-list mailing list - sponsored by www.HW.cz
> Hw-list na list.hw.cz
> http://list.hw.cz/mailman/listinfo/hw-list
Další informace o konferenci Hw-list